On Wed, Feb 07, 2018 at 02:21:06PM +0000, Suzuki K Poulose wrote: > Expose the new features introduced by Arm v8.4 extensions to > Arm v8-A profile. > > These include : > > 1) Data indpendent timing of instructions. (DIT, exposed as HWCAP_DIT) > 2) Unaligned atomic instructions and Single-copy atomicity of loads > and stores. (AT, expose as HWCAP_USCAT) > 3) LDAPR and STLR instructions with immediate offsets (extension to > LRCPC, exposed as HWCAP_ILRCPC) > 4) Flag manipulation instructions (TS, exposed as HWCAP_FLAGM).
Please resend this but continuing with the default of FTR_STRICT, as we currently have. That way this can be merged while we work out what we want to do there.
> While at it get rid of the RES0 entries in the cpu-feature-registers.txt > documentation, as: > 1) We care only about the user visible fields. > 2) The field may not be up-to-date > 3) We already explain the rules of the fields if it is not visible.
Please spin this part as a separate patch.
